Welcome! Your car looks great, nice pics. I think you'll appreciate the car even more as time passes.

I see Trey pointed out the dreaded water drip. The G has more nooks and crannies than any car I can remember. It takes quite a few passes with the leaf blower at the door handles, side mirrors, gas flap and the lowers gap along the doors to keep your G from getting the drips.
